Where Are 24/7 EV Charging Stations Located?
Finding 24/7 EV charging stations is especially important during late-night highway drives or early-morning commutes. Knowing where to look and checking real-time charger status can make your journey easier.
Round-the-clock charging points are typically available at high-traffic, accessible locations such as highways, fuel stations, dedicated charging hubs, and some commercial facilities.
- Highway Amenities & Fuel Outlets: Major public charging networks operate EV chargers at fuel stations and highway locations, making them convenient for long-distance travel.
- Dedicated Charging Hubs: High-power DC fast-charging hubs from networks such as ChargeZone, Statiq, and Tata Power EZ Charge can provide convenient charging for compatible EVs.
- Hotels & Commercial Hubs: Some hotels, parking facilities, and commercial locations provide EV charging access, although entry hours may vary by property.
What Apps Can I Use to Check 24/7 EV Charging Availability?
Before driving to an EV charging station late at night, use charging apps and maps to check live charger availability, access restrictions, and operational status.
| App / Network | Key Features & Coverage |
|---|---|
| PlugShare | Community-based charging information with user check-ins, photos, reviews, and location details. |
| Tata Power EZ Charge | Provides access to a large EV charging network across cities, highways, and intercity routes. |
| Statiq | Offers EV charging locations with station information and availability features in supported locations. |
| BPCL Pulse / Jio-bp Pulse | Useful for finding EV charging facilities located at fuel stations and highway travel routes. |
| ChargeZone | Focuses on high-power DC fast charging infrastructure across intercity routes and major travel corridors. |
What Should You Verify Before a Late-Night EV Charging Trip?
A station may appear on a map but still have an occupied or unavailable charger. Always check the latest information before travelling.
- Live Socket Availability: Check that the charger is marked as Available rather than Occupied or Offline.
- Site Gate Policies: Some chargers may technically operate 24/7 while the property itself has restricted entry hours. Fuel stations and dedicated highway charging hubs can be more convenient for late-night access.
- Connector Compatibility: Check whether your EV requires a CCS2 DC fast charger, Type-2 AC charger, or another compatible connector.
- Payment Method: Make sure your charging app is ready for payment. Keep UPI, a linked card, or another supported payment method available to avoid delays.
Why Is Real-Time EV Charger Status Important?
Real-time availability helps EV drivers avoid reaching a station only to find that the charger is occupied, offline, or temporarily unavailable.
This is especially useful for highway travel, where the next fast charging station may be several kilometres away.
